İşaretçi, C ve C++ gibi bazı üst düzey bilgisayar programlama dillerinin, programcının bellek konumlarını doğrudan değiştirmesine olanak tanıyan bir özelliğidir. İşaretçiler, yazılım uygulamaları için belleğin işlenmesinde daha fazla esneklik sağlar ve genellikle programın yürütülmesi sırasında veri depolamak ve almak için kullanılır.

İşaretçi, sayısal veya dize değeri yerine başka bir değişkenin bellek adresini içeren özel bir değişken türüdür. İşaretçiler, bir bilgisayar programının belleğe doğrudan erişmesine olanak tanır ve onlara belleğin tahsis edilme ve kullanılma şekli üzerinde bir düzeyde kontrol sağlar. Bir işaretçinin belleğe hızla erişme yeteneği, diğer veri erişim yöntemlerine göre önemli performans avantajları sağlar.

İşaretçiler çeşitli uygulamalarda yararlı olabilir. Dizinin öğelerine doğrudan bir bağlantı sağlayarak veya tahsis edilen belleğe referansları koruyarak bir programın dizi boyunca hızlı bir şekilde yinelenmesini sağlar ve böylece bellek parçalanmasını azaltır. İşaretçiler aynı zamanda nesneler arasındaki ilişkileri ifade etmenin bir yolunu sağladıkları nesne yönelimli programlamada da kullanılır.

Yanlış kullanıldıklarında programlarda hatalara yol açabilecekleri için işaretçilerin dikkatli kullanılması gerektiğini anlamak önemlidir. Yönetilmeyen işaretçiler, C ve C++ programlarındaki bellek sızıntılarının başlıca kaynaklarından biridir ve doğru kullanılmadıklarında önemli bir güvenlik sorunu kaynağı olabilirler.

Proxy Seçin ve Satın Alın

Veri Merkezi Proxyleri

Dönen Proxyler

UDP Proxyleri

Dünya Çapında 10.000'den Fazla Müşterinin Güvendiği

Vekil Müşteri
Vekil Müşteri
Vekil Müşteri flowch.ai
Vekil Müşteri
Vekil Müşteri
Vekil Müşteri